The only time the PAIR system allows air into the exhaust is at idle.
It is mainly there to warm up the CAT quickly to reduce emmissions at zero throttle.
If you have no Cat, ie aftermarket headers or removed cat, there isnt much point except it will still aid the combustion of any unburned gases in the exhaust.
If you have your bike dynoed, they will disable the PAIR to stop getting false AFR readings during its operation.
One downside to the PAIR system is it does make the idle exhaust louder due to the combustion which is going on in the exhaust system at idle. this may be an issue if you are running an aftermarket exhaust with no baffles. (like most people).

PAIR valve is open at idle and is also open on the overrun (decelerating). Don't believe me? Go for a ride with the solenoid connected, and decelerate (listen to the burbling noise). Then disconect the solenoid and go riding again - no burbling.
Honda Australia themselves were recommending restrictor plates in the PAIR lines for some owners to overcome some fuelling problems caused by PAIR valves.
If you want to tune the bike, disabling them is recommended. Also, if you have an Autotune they're practically a must because otherwise you get completely stuffed O2 readings whenever you're decelerating and at 2% throttle or so.

There's a lot of misconceptions about the operation of the PAIR. I unplugged the PAIR solenoid and connected a 12v lamp in it's place for a couple weeks on my '06. The lamp would only light when the bike was below 160(ish) degrees and the throttle was closed. Once the bike was up to temp or the throttle was off idle, the solenoid was closed (light off).
It's purpose is to add a little oxygen to the exhaust to help burn left over hydrocarbons. Since the mixture is richer while warming, this would make sense. Burning the extra hydrocarbons while warming, also aids in heating the cat and O2 sensor so they can function properly, sooner. It would seem once warm, the cat does a good enough job without the PAIR. The bike won't go into closed loop until warm, when the PAIR system is not used.
Removing it might extend the time it takes the bike to come up to temp. Removing it also leaves one less thing to go 'bad'. A leaking PAIR could cause a lot of problems in closed loop. I removed mine for that very reason.

Results on my 03 VFR800
PAIR Valve with gutted pipe = popping during deceleration
PAIR Valve removed with gutted pipe = no popping during deceleration
I removed the PAIR Valve, sync'd the starter valves, and added the TurboCity High Pressure Fuel Regulater at the same time to eliminate the 4k-5k dead spot and the twitchy throttle.........Not sure which of these cured the problem, but the above stated worked 95% of the time. I later added the power commander to completely eliminate the issues.
